Some quick array operations using python lists and numpy to get a feeling for performance

import sys | |
import time | |
import numpy as np | |
""" | |
Just a quick non scientific performance test for iterables from python and numpy. | |
This is only meant to get a rough feeling for different performances. | |
""" | |
def test_speed(array): | |
""" | |
Takes an iterable and measures the time it takes to iterate over the array in different ways | |
:param: list, numpy array or other iterable | |
""" | |
print(f"running tests type: {type(array)} with {len(array)} entries") | |
# for in range | |
start = time.time() | |
for i in range(len(array)): | |
array[i] = array[i] + 1 | |
t2 = time.time() | |
print(f"ran for in range {t2 - start}") | |
# ---------- | |
# for enumerate | |
start = time.time() | |
for i, elm in enumerate(array): | |
array[i] = elm + 1 | |
t2 = time.time() | |
print(f"ran for in enum {t2 - start}") | |
# ---------- | |
# comprehension | |
start = time.time() | |
a_2 = [e + 1 for e in array] | |
t2 = time.time() | |
print(f"ran comprehension {t2 - start}") | |
# ---------- | |
# while | |
start = time.time() | |
i = 0 | |
while i < len(array): | |
array[i] = array[i] + 1 | |
i += 1 | |
t2 = time.time() | |
print(f"ran while loop {t2 - start}") | |
# ---------- | |
# recursion? | |
# I tried but then I realized that this is python | |
# default recursion depth 1k you can adjust it | |
# but it won't let you do crazy stuff like 20k | |
# ---------- | |
# do type specific things list | |
if type(array) is list: | |
start = time.time() | |
a_2 = np.array(array) | |
t2 = time.time() | |
print(f"conversion np.array {t2 - start}") | |
# ---------- | |
# type specific numpy | |
if type(array) is np.ndarray: | |
start = time.time() | |
array += array + 1 | |
t2 = time.time() | |
print(f"ran numpy internal {t2 - start}") | |
start = time.time() | |
a_2 = list(array) | |
t2 = time.time() | |
print(f"conversion list: {t2 - start}") |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
# python list | |
array = [i for i in range(2000000)] | |
test_speed(array) | |
print() | |
# numpy array | |
array = np.arange(0, 2000000) | |
test_speed(array) |
